The Nonwovens Institute (NWI) is the world’s first accredited academic program for the interdisciplinary study of engineered fabrics through an innovative partnership of industry, government, and academe. NWI engages experts from industry and higher education in building next-generation nonwoven applications while also providing training and guidance to the field’s future leaders. NWI plays a key role in the development and transformation of the latest innovations into marketable fiber-based systems through access to state-of-the-art pilot and testing facilities.
The tour is limited to the first 60 people who register (to ensure safety) and will focus on these facilities within NWI’s Labs: large- and small-scale units for Spunbond, Bonding (including hydroentanglement, thermal calendar, and through air), Meltblown, Carding (crosslapping, Needlepunch, and heated oven), Filament Spinning, Coating and Lamination, Filtration Testing, and Analytical.

Tour the North Carolina State University Wilson College of Textiles lab facilities, including the Weaving Lab, Knitting Lab, Short-Staple Spinning Lab, Physical Testing Lab, and Dyeing and Finishing Lab, which are managed by Zeis Textiles Extension for Economic Development. These fully functioning labs are used for both educational purposes and contracted projects with industry partners for product testing and production. In addition to the Zeis Textiles Extension, tour the Textile Protection and Comfort Center and ASSIST Center's labs for innovation and testing. These facilities are more closely related to heat and flame protection, chemical resistance, and comfort performance research, and wearable and implantable systems, respectively.
